Website design By BotEap.comHere’s the quick rundown of the OnePlus 6 mobile phone specs:

  • Display: 6.28-inch optical AMOLED touchscreen
  • Resolution: Full HD (2160 x 1080)
  • Aspect ratio: 19: 9
  • Pixel Density: 402ppi
  • Protection: Corning Gorilla Glass 5
  • Processor: Qualcomm Snapdragon 845 Octa-core
  • Graphics processor: Adreno 630
  • RAM: 6GB / 8GB
  • Operating system: Android 8.1 with Oxygen OS
  • Rear camera: Dual 16MP + 20MP with dual LED flash
  • Front camera: 16MP
  • Storage: 64/128 / 256GB
  • Battery: 3300 mAh Li-Po (non-removable)
  • Connectivity: Wi-Fi 802.11 a / b / g / n / ac, dual band, Wi-Fi Direct, access point
  • Bluetooth version: Bluetooth 5.0
  • Sensors: fingerprint, accelerometer, gyroscope, proximity, compass
  • Available colors: silk white, sandstone black
  • Weight: 175 grams
Website design By BotEap.comOnePlus 6 availability in Australia

Website design By BotEap.comA limited number of OnePlus 5 devices were available in Australia via a soft launch, but not an official launch for the OnePlus 5T. Unfortunately, the Australian launch of the OnePlus 6 is still on hold. And there is no confirmation of the date it will reach the local market.

Website design By BotEap.comAs for the actual global launch, it took place on May 17, 2018. The device went on sale on May 22 in various parts of the world, and is now available from a variety of direct importers, including Amazon Australia.

Website design By BotEap.comOnePlus 6 price in Australia

Website design By BotEap.comThe OnePlus 6 price in Australia will depend on the variant selected. The basic variant with 6GB of RAM and 64GB of onboard memory retails for AU $ 753. For the 8GB RAM and 128GB variant, it will cost you around AU $ 853, while the 8GB RAM and 256GB variant will cost you around from AU $ 950.
